CAREER NOTES: A two-year letterwinner and one-year starter at TU after spending her first season at TCU … Played in 59 games and started in 22 for the Golden Hurricane ... Has career averages of 6.5 points (465), 3.4 rebounds (243) and 1.3 assists (92) … Has two double-doubles, 18 double-figure scoring games, including two 20+ point contests, and two double-digit rebounding performances, all for Tulsa.
2025-25: Played in 29 games and started in 21 for Tulsa as a junior.
2024-25: Started in one of 30 games played for Tulsa.
2023-24: Played in 13 games as a true freshman for TCU.

HIGH SCHOOL
- Played four varsity seasons at Austin High School for her mother and head coach, Emerald Amen.
- Was a four-star recruit by ESPN.com.
- Was a 2023 McDonald’s All-American.
- Named District 26-6A MVP in 2022.
- Led her team to the regional quarterfinals.
- Earned Class 6A TABC all-state and TABC all-region team accolades her junior year.
- Was an academic all-district selection all four years.
- Also lettered in volleyball and track.
